In laying out any bond pattern, it is important that the corners be started correctly. A stretcher is a unit laid horizontally so the unit’s longest end is parallel to the wall face. A header course consists entirely of headers (horizontal, short, narrow side laid on wide edge). The common terms used in masonry works are listed below. Each horizontal layer of brick in a masonry structure is called a course. It is a full brick or stone which is laid with its length perpendicular to the face of the wall. Historically, brick courses played a vital role in the stabilization of a wall, more notably, different brick courses could help support a wall at a window or door opening. Whether you're a homeowner planning a diy project or simply curious about the world of brickwork, understanding key masonry terms is essential. Common or american bond is a variation of running bond with a course of full length headers at regular intervals. In masonry, the three most popular course types are stretcher courses, header courses and soldier courses. Bonds In Brick Work Means Method Of Arranging The Bricks In Courses So That Individual Brick Units Are Tied Together And The Vertical Joints Of The Successive Courses Do Not Lie In Same Vertical Line.
